One key process that has become crucial in the development and manufacturing of biopharmaceuticals is lyophilization, also known as freeze-drying. This process involves removing water from a product through freezing and sublimation, resulting in a stable and long-lasting final product. One of the key drivers of the lyophilization services market is the rise in the development and approval of biopharmaceutical products. Biopharmaceuticals are complex molecules that are derived from living organisms, making them more susceptible to degradation and instability. Lyophilization has emerged as a preferred method for stabilizing these sensitive molecules, as it helps preserve their structural integrity and bioactivity, ensuring a longer shelf-life and improved efficacy.

In addition to the growing demand for biopharmaceutical products, the lyophilization services market is also being propelled by advancements in lyophilization technology. Manufacturers are constantly investing in research and development to enhance lyophilization processes, improve product quality, and reduce production costs. Innovative techniques such as controlled ice nucleation and in-process monitoring have revolutionized the lyophilization process, enabling manufacturers to produce high-quality lyophilized products with greater efficiency and precision.
